Edwards County taxpayers ranked 88th in total sales taxes paid per county in September, according to Illinois tax records.

In total, Edwards County residents paid $68,002 in sales taxes during September.

Edwards County ranked 89th in the Prairie State the month before, with $58,367 spent in sales taxes.

The County School Facility Tax accounted for the largest share of sales taxes paid by Edwards County residents in September.
